Fake journo refuses to pay youth his remuneration but kidnaps, arrested

Cuttack: A fake journalist was arrested today after he refused to pay a youth his remuneration, whom the accused had engaged in work here, but allegedly kidnapped the latter. However, Sadar police have arrested the wrongdoer.

The arrested was identified as Sashi Bhushan Sahu (32), who impersonated to be a journalist working in a New Delhi-based magazine named ‘Human Touch’. Sashi Bhushan belongs to Purbagadia locality under Baideswar police limits and Banki town of Cuttack district.

The abductee has been identified as Rakesh Sahu from Chhatia of Jajpur district.

According to a senior official in Sadar police station, Sashi Bhushan and few of his aides had engaged the victim youth earlier by issuing a fabricated identity card in the latter’s favour. Subsequently, Rakesh could know that the identity card issued to him was a manipulated one.

By that time, Rakesh had already worked for the ill-motivated Sashi Bhushan for a few days. Hence, the victim denied to work anymore and demanded his remuneration for those days.

Irked with the demand of Rakesh, Sashi Bhushan kidnapped the victim youth. The accused and his aides were on their way from Kathjodi bridge end of Gopalpur in Banki town to Bhubaneswar.

The speeding vehicle was passing via Panagada Square when they were intercepted by some locals near Ganesh temple in Kazipatana. Later, the locals informed police about it.

However, one of the kidnappers managed to flee from the spot before police reached there.

Police team nabbed two others and detained both of them including Sashi Bhushan for quizzing. The arrested was forwarded to a local court later in the day, the senior official stated.

Sadar police have also seized a Sports Utility Vehicle (SUV) engaged in the crime.
